Description
American Traveler is hiring an experienced RN for a Level IV NICU position requiring a minimum of 2 years total NICU III/IV experience with at least 1 year in a Level IV NICU.
Details
- Work in the NICU of a Level One Pediatric Trauma Center and Level IV NICU at a Magnet-designated pediatric hospital
- Care for neonates ranging from under 24-28 weeks to over 34 weeks gestation
- Patient ratios range from 1:1 to 1:3
- Day and night shift options available, each 3x12 hour shifts
- Day shift 7:00am-7:30pm and night shift 7:00pm-7:30am, Monday through Friday
- Required to work 2-3 weekends per 6-week scheduling period
- Floating required as needed
- Uses Epic charting system
- Care involves post-op patients, g-tubes, trach/vent management, and various modes of invasive/noninvasive ventilation
Requirements
- Active WI RN license or compact license required
- BLS and NRP certification required (AHA only)
- PALS certification preferred
- Minimum 2 years total NICU III/IV experience required, with at least 1 year in a Level IV NICU
- Prior travel experience required, with at least one completed Level IV NICU assignment preferred
- First-time travelers with Level IV NICU experience may be considered
- Epic experience required, preferably within the last 12 months
- Teaching hospital experience preferred
- Must pass telemetry exam with strict passing criteria prior to start, including adult and pediatric rhythm identification components
- Skills in IV therapy, UAC/UVC management, neonatal dosage calculations, and respiratory support required
Additional Information
- Provide specialized nursing care to critically ill neonates, including those requiring ventilator management, therapeutic hypothermia, and neonatal abstinence syndrome care
- Support developmental care practices and patient/family teaching
- Manage central lines, arterial lines, and administer blood products, vasopressors, and other emergency medications as needed

About
Madison is the capital of Wisconsin, located about an hour west of Milwaukee. Frequently listed as one of the best places to live in the United States, this city ranks high in economy, diversity and education. Madison is a young and vibrant Midwestern town and is the home of the University of Wisconsin Madison, a top-ranked public institution. Visitors can’t miss the iconic Wisconsin State Capitol Building, a beautiful historic building located on a strip of land between Lakes Mendota and Monona, or the Olbrich Botanical Gardens, open year-round and boasting over 16 gardens. To really get a feel for this lively city, take a stroll down State Street, with seven blocks of bustling restaurants, beach access and street art.
